  vishay sml4728 to sml4764a document number 85782 rev. 2, 25-mar-03 vishay semiconductors www.vishay.com 1 15811 surface mount zener diodes \ features ? plastic package has underwriters laboratory flammability classification 94 v-0  for surface mounted applications  low zener impedance  low regulation factor  high temperature soldering guaranteed: 260 c/10 seconds at terminals  standard voltage tolerance is 10 %, suffix a 5 %. mechanical data case: jedec do-214ac molded plastic over passivated junction terminals: solder plated, solderable per mil-std- 750, method 2026 polarity: color band denotes positive end (cathode) mounting position: any weight: 0.002 ounce, 64 mg packaging codes - options (antistatic): sml4728 - sml4737a: 2p - 1.8k per 7" plastic reel (12mm tape), 36k/carton 2q - 7.5k per 13" plastic reel (12mm tape), 75k/carton sml4738 - sml4764a: 61 - 1.8k per 7" plastic reel (12mm tape), 36k/carton 5a - 7.5k per 13" plastic reel (12mm tape), 75k/carton absolute maximum ratings t amb = 25 c, unless otherwise specified maximum thermal resistance t amb = 25 c, unless otherwise specified parameter te s t c o n d i t i o n symbol va lu e unit power dissipation t l = 75 c p tot 1.0 w parameter tes t co nd iti on symbol value unit maximum junction temperature t j 150 c storage temperature range t s - 65 to + 150 c
